


The AEW Collision event began live from GalaxyCon In the Greater Columbus Convention Center, Columbus, Ohio, with Tony Schiavone, Matt Menard and Nigel McGuinness at the comment table.
Continental Classic Gold League – Darby Allin vs. Komander
Winner: Darby Allin (3 points)
Komander dominated at the beginning with aerial movements, but Darby resisted with intense attacks, including a Coffin Drop In the upper rope. Komander tried a Shooting Star Pressbut Darby avoided it and immobilized it with a grapevine pin.

Continental Classic Blue League – Kyle Fletcher vs. Kazuchika Okada
Winner: Kyle Fletcher
In the end Fletcher showed cunning when using a low blow and a sheerdrop brainbuster To overcome Okada, adding another important victory.
